What does a part time math teacher do?

As a part-time math teacher, your responsibilities are to teach students key math concepts through a tutoring lesson, which may be an after-school session or in a school classroom during the day. You carry out your duties throughout the school day or after school, providing students with extra teaching and math coursework in specific areas in which they need more help. These positions can be for up to 35 hours each week, and you may travel to different schools or students’ homes. Some part-time math teaching positions are virtual tutoring jobs you can do from home by connecting to students via a webcam to conduct lessons.

What is the difference between Part Time Math Teacher vs Part Time Math Tutor?

AspectPart Time Math TeacherPart Time Math Tutor
CredentialsTypically requires a teaching certification or relevant degreeUsually no formal certification required, but expertise in math needed
Work EnvironmentSchool classrooms, educational institutionsPrivate sessions, online platforms, tutoring centers
Employer & Industry UsageSchools, districts, educational organizationsIndividual clients, tutoring companies, online platforms
Common Search & Comparison IntentLooking for formal teaching roles in schoolsSeeking personalized, flexible math help outside school

Part Time Math Teachers typically work in educational institutions with formal credentials, focusing on classroom instruction. In contrast, Part Time Math Tutors often operate independently or through tutoring platforms, providing one-on-one or small group sessions without necessarily requiring formal teaching credentials. Both roles aim to improve students' math skills but differ mainly in work setting and certification requirements.

What are some common challenges faced by part time math teachers, and how can they successfully manage their workload across multiple classes or schools?

Part-time math teachers often juggle teaching responsibilities across different classes or even multiple schools, which can make lesson planning and grading more complex. Managing varying curricula, adapting to different school cultures, and keeping track of students’ progress can be particularly challenging. To succeed, it's important to maintain organized schedules, use digital tools for planning and communication, and build strong relationships with both full-time staff and students. Collaboration and clear communication with colleagues ensure consistency in instruction and help address students' individual needs effectively.
